Analysis

The most recent figure for burning - crop residues — emissions (co2eq) from ch4 in Yugoslav SFR is 210.89 kt, measured in 1991. That is the lowest value across all 31 years on record.

That represents a change of down 1.5% on the previous year and down 2.3% over ten years.

Over the whole period, burning - crop residues — emissions (co2eq) from ch4 in Yugoslav SFR peaked at 251.04 kt in 1962 and was at its lowest, 210.89 kt, in 1991.

That places Yugoslav SFR 27th out of 183 countries with data for 1991, putting it in the top quarter.

The long-run direction has been consistently falling across the 31 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
